TL;DR. golang.org/x/net/idna.Lookup.ToASCII runs UTS-46 NFKC mapping 0-9. A pre-IDNA net.ParseIP check rejects the NO_PROXY lists, TLS-SNI routers, and cookie-domain validators that TrimRight + ParseAddr golang.org/x/net/http/httpproxy, the canonical safe pattern, and two I ran into this one while writing a Go HTTP client for a private project. I idna.Lookup.ToASCII canonicalising the host The sha
Ladybird Browser Engine: SerenityOS's Bold Challenge to Web Monoculture In a technology landscape often characterized by incremental feature additions and layers of abstraction, the endeavor of constructing a new web browser engine from the ground up in the 21st century appears, to many, as an exercise in futility. Industry analysts and seasoned engineers frequently dismiss such projects as econ